TICKET-2290: Nightly jobs migrated from cron to the Weftline workflow engine stopped running Monday. Root cause: the credential minted during migration expired and auto-renewal was never enabled. Support should advise affected teams that reruns are safe once the secret is rotated. The replacement key for the Weftline scheduler service is below.

gateway credential: zpat4_qSKI

Quarterly planning note for the finance team. Short version: warranty costs on the Pinecrest heater line came in about 40% over plan, driven by the faulty thermostat batch from the Delham plant. Rennie's team has the fix in production already, but claims will keep trickling in through Q1. We're proposing to top up the warranty reserve rather than trim marketing. Before you push back on the numbers, read the context we've added below.

board note of kagep-yahig: Only 9 of the 120 pilot accounts renewed Quenix, so a churn review is set for April 1.

When the Paylode payroll export switched from fixed-width to delimited format (release 4.2), the service account used by the Glenmoor finance bridge was rotated, and older recovery tokens became invalid. If the bridge account locks during a format migration, do not re-run the exporter; first restore access through the Paylode admin vault. Confirm the export schema version matches the finance bridge manifest before unlocking. The vault prompt will ask for the recovery passphrase, which is recorded below.

vault phrase of bagaf-kajeg = jorath-feniel-briir-siliel-ralix

Ticket: config drift detected on the Lanternvale product catalog cache tier. Node group C is invalidating on a 30s TTL while the rest honour event-driven purges, causing stale prices after the Fenner flash sale. Drift likely came from a manual hotfix that never landed in the repo. Please hold the release until all nodes match the expected values listed below.

settings of fafog-haduf:
ZORIX_PIN=4648
ZORIX_METRICS_HOST=metrics.zorix.paliqsys.corp
ZORIX_LOG_LEVEL=info
ZORIX_TENANT=druix